美欧贸易协定框架多处表述“暗指中国”?港媒:或给欧中关系带来“新裂痕”
Huan Qiu Shi Bao· 2025-08-22 22:51
Core Points - The United States and the European Union have reached an agreement on a trade framework, indicating a shift towards closer cooperation in technology, security, and commerce [1] - The agreement includes a reduction of tariffs, with the US imposing a maximum of 15% tariffs on EU products, while the EU will eliminate many tariffs on US goods [1] - The framework encompasses 19 areas, including agriculture, automobiles, aircraft, semiconductors, energy, environmental regulations, cybersecurity, and digital trade barriers [1] Group 1 - The EU plans to procure at least $40 billion worth of US artificial intelligence chips and align on technology security standards to prevent sensitive technology from reaching "relevant destinations," primarily targeting China [1][2] - The EU is committed to large-scale purchases of US energy products, including liquefied natural gas, oil, and nuclear energy, with expected purchases reaching $750 billion by 2028 [2] - European companies are set to invest an additional $600 billion in strategic sectors in the US and increase military and defense equipment procurement [2] Group 2 - The agreement marks a significant shift in EU-US relations, moving away from previous tensions and reflecting a decision by the EU to deepen cooperation with the US [2] - The resumption of economic security cooperation includes bilateral investment reviews and export controls aimed at limiting China's access to advanced technologies [2]
